Choosing the Right Nursery Cot: A Comprehensive Guide for New Parents

Welcoming a new baby into the world is one of the most happy experiences in life, and producing a safe and comfy nursery for your child is an important part of this journey. Among the most essential furniture pieces in any nursery is the cot. A nursery cot provides a safe sleeping environment for babies, protecting them throughout their vulnerable first months. This post will look into the various types of nursery cots readily available, their functions, what to search for when acquiring one, and responses to often asked concerns.

Kinds Of Nursery Cots

When picking a cot for your nursery, it's essential to comprehend the various types readily available. Below is a table summing up various nursery cots and their characteristics.

Kind of CotDescriptionProsCons
Standard CotA standard fixed-sided crib that can be utilized for infants and toddlers.Tough, long-lasting, safe and secure.Bulky, may not fit small spaces.
Convertible CotA cot that can be converted into a young child bed or daybed as the kid grows.Versatile, cost-efficient in the long run.Initial expense can be higher.
Portable CotA light-weight crib created for travel and easy motion around the home.Easy to store and move; appropriate for travel.May do not have durability and assistance.
Co-SleeperA smaller sized baby crib that attaches to the side of the moms and dads' bed for simple access during the night.Promotes bonding; easy feedings in the evening.Minimal use as the kid grows.
BassinetA smaller, portable sleeping area for babies, often with a rocking function.Compact, light-weight, ideal for small areas.Limited life expectancy; normally just for newborns.

Secret Features to Consider

When browsing for the perfect nursery cot, a number of functions need to be considered. Below is a list of crucial functions to look for:

  1. Safety Standards: Ensure the cot satisfies all security guidelines set by your country. Search for accreditations such as ASTM or JPMA in the United States.

  2. Adjustable Mattress Heights: Cots with adjustable heights allow you to reduce the mattress as your baby grows and ends up being more mobile.

  3. Sturdy Construction: Ensure the cot is made from top quality products, ensuring durability and stability.

  4. Non-toxic Finishes: Since infants tend to chew on their cots, make sure that the wood finishes are non-toxic and safe for babies.

  5. Ease of Assembly: Look for cots that are simple to put together and disassemble, particularly if you prepare to move it frequently.

  6. Excellent ventilation: A cot with slatted sides enables air flow, lowering the risk of suffocation or getting too hot.

Purchasing Considerations

Before making a purchase, consider the following:

  • Budget: Establish a budget plan that fits your financial circumstance. Nursery cots can range considerably in rate based on their features and materials.

  • Area Requirements: Measure the offered area in the nursery to make sure the cot fits comfortably without overcrowding the room.

  • Longevity: Consider whether you desire a cot that will last through numerous kids or one that serves a particular purpose for just one child.

Maintenance Tips

A nursery cot requires routine upkeep to guarantee it stays safe and functional. Here are some tips to bear in mind:

  • Regular Checks: Frequently examine the cot for any loose screws or parts.

  • Cleaning up: Clean the cot with moderate soap and water, preventing harsh chemicals that can affect the finish or be hazardous to your baby.

  • Bed mattress Care: Ensure the bed mattress fits comfortably within the cot to avoid spaces where the baby might end up being stuck. Replace it if it becomes worn or saggy.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. When should I shift my baby from a crib to a young child bed?

The majority of children transition between 18 months and 3 years old. It's important to try to find indications such as climbing up out of the baby crib or outgrowing the cot.

2. Can I use a second-hand cot?

Yes, however ensure it satisfies present security requirements and hasn't been remembered. Inspect for wear and tear too.

3. What type of mattress is best for a nursery cot?

A firm, flat mattress is suggested for babies to minimize the risk of suffocation and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S). Guarantee it fits the cot comfortably.

4. How can I guarantee my baby is safe while oversleeping the cot?

  • Always place your baby on their back to sleep.
  • Avoid using soft bedding, pillows, or toys in the cot.
  • Ensure the cot satisfies safety standards and is totally free from dangers.

5. What are the finest products for nursery cots?

Strong wood is typically the most long lasting option, while some moms and dads might choose baby cribs made of metal or composite materials. Always check for non-toxic finishes.
